Transaction cd568dd51fc80f743b5ba699c5c0bc390c42482e1aff4b104714661f7b76a39d
2 Input
2 Outputs
- cd568dd51fc80f743b5ba699c5c0bc390c42482e1aff4b104714661f7b76a39d:0
- cd568dd51fc80f743b5ba699c5c0bc390c42482e1aff4b104714661f7b76a39d:1
value 26916000
address 15Dr8v5UHo6digetuCmGpAoSxieCgH8cHJ
value 8321
address 1D4wPBsdGtd5PKkTCB8nCSkZNguPPr4XuL